Emmanuel Emenike Not Pleased Karabukspor Fans Jeered At Him
Published: December 24, 2013
In Fenerbahce’s last match in the Super League against Karabükspor, the home fans tormented former player Emmanuel Emenike.
The 26 - year - old attacker was jeered and booed by the crowd and he was not pleased with their action.
Fanatik.com.tr quoted Emmanuel Emenike as saying: “I did not deserve this behavior because my best performances in the league came in that city.
“And because of this situation, they should show me some understanding. I am a professional footballer.
“Currently I am defending the colors of Fenerbahce. I must fight on behalf of my team to win, it is normal.”
In the ongoing season, the Super Eagles marksman has notched up 7 goals in 15 matches.
